Little Red-haired Girl

by Bill Schott

He Loves Me, He Loves Me Not Contest Winner 

Your memory still finds me,
even as decades fall between us;
long, orange hair that feels like love
frames your speckled cheeks and chin.

We share my sandwich at school,
for you have no lunch to eat;
never a lunch, but always hungry.

One day you stay at home.
You are sick...
still sick...
still sick all summer.

You are my first love.
I know it from the loss I still feel
after sixty years.
